What’s the Average Cost to Remove Squirrels in Florida?

Squirrel removal costs in Florida typically range from $200 to $700, which aligns fairly closely with the national average. Still, no two infestations are alike. If you’re dealing with a minor issue—say, one squirrel tucked into the attic—the lower end of that range might apply. But once you add nesting materials, a higher number of squirrels, or chewed wires and insulation, the cost of removing them starts to increase. Cleanup, exclusion, and repair work are often needed to fix squirrel damage and prevent future infestations.

For homeowners across the Treasure Coast—including Stuart, Vero Beach, and Port St. Lucie—pricing also depends on property layout and how accessible the affected areas are. Two-story homes, tight crawlspaces, or extensive contamination all require more time, labor, and materials. That’s why professional squirrel removal is the smart choice. What Factors Influence Squirrel Removal Pricing?

No two squirrel jobs are priced the same, and that’s because several key factors shape the total cost. From the number of animals to the level of cleanup needed, here’s what typically affects how much you’ll pay to remove the squirrel and prevent re-entry. Choosing professional animal removal or pest control services ensures each of these variables is properly addressed.

1. Severity of the Infestation

A higher number of squirrels means more traps, more labor, and more potential for property damage. While it may be straightforward to rid of squirrels in minor cases, a full nest—especially with babies—requires multiple visits, follow-up care, and strategic planning that only experienced removal services can provide.

2. Location of Entry Points

Are squirrels getting in through the roof, soffit, or vents? If access points are hidden or high up, more effort is needed to inspect, seal, and secure them. Homes with several vulnerable areas often require more extensive pest control and exclusion work to prevent repeat visits.

3. Presence of Baby Squirrels or a Den

When a squirrel has created a den inside your attic or walls, humane handling becomes essential. Our removal services at AAAC Wildlife Removal are equipped to safely extract babies, check for hidden nesting spots, and remove the squirrel family without causing distress or damage.

4. Exclusion and Repair Work

Getting squirrels out is step one. Step two is making sure they can’t come back. Sealing entry holes, replacing chewed materials, and reinforcing common access points are all part of long-term animal removal strategy—and they affect the total cost.

5. Cleanup and Sanitation

Squirrel damage isn’t just structural—it’s biological. Droppings, nesting debris, and chewed wires are serious health and safety risks. Proper sanitation and odor control are critical parts of pest control and can influence your final bill depending on the size of the mess.

Is Squirrel Removal Covered by Insurance?

In some cases, yes—but it really depends on your policy and how the damage occurred. Most homeowners insurance will only cover squirrel-related issues if the damage is considered sudden and accidental. For example, if a squirrel in the attic chews through electrical wires and causes a fire, your provider might help with repairs. But if the infestation developed over time, it may be viewed as a maintenance issue—and that usually isn’t covered.

It’s also important to know that homeowners insurance doesn’t typically cover the cost to get rid of squirrels. The trapping, cleanup, and exclusion work are often left to the homeowner. Humane, Legal Practices

Many homeowners are surprised to learn that Florida has very specific regulations around wildlife removal—including squirrels. You can’t simply trap and relocate animals, especially when babies are involved.
